LAHORE (92 News) – The Joint Action Committee (JAC) of Pakistan International Airlines’ (PIA) employees has on Wednesday presented its demands during the meeting with Punjab Chief Minister Shahbaz Sharif.

A seven-member delegation of JAC led by Captain Baloch and comprising of Nasir Mehdi Janjua, Safdar Anjum, Hidayatullah, Zakir Farooq, Shahid Qureshi and Mahmood Bukhari met with Punjab Chief Minister Shahbaz Sharif and presented its demands.

The demands include:

  • To suspend the privatization of national flag carrier for one year,
  • To provide Air330 Bus and 777 aircrafts,
  • As many as 18 domestic routes should be closed
